Is It Normal For A Pomeranian To Bark A Lot?

Pomeranians are one of the most vocal dog breeds. They are known for their high-pitched “barks” and for being very talkative. Pomeranians often bark when they are excited, anxious, or trying to get attention. While some people find this breed’s vocalization charming, others may find it annoying.
